To ‘garment dye’ a piece of clothing is to first assemble the product in its raw form, then have it colored to your liking as one of the final steps before they ship to retail. This technique results in an intense coloration that’s predisposed to fading and thus, a custom-fit look, so if you didn’t already have enough reasons that the Converse Jack Purcell should be a part of your regular rotation, the 1 of 1 aged appeal pushes them over the top. The Jack Purcell has a surprisingly comfortable footbed hiding inside its ‘smile’-toed sole and at a pricetag of only sixty bucks, you can afford to get all three of the colorups now available at Kith.
